Output 643ceb9a1ccc399249dd4e711868a59feea0320532355b20ad030719caafc8fa:3

value
404332869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e291f38b769fe0cb3241d5db91a7dcdc84e5b64 OP_EQUAL
address
MF2SCbZoVVjq3w3FeVRa58uzkw2n3rHFJi
transaction
643ceb9a1ccc399249dd4e711868a59feea0320532355b20ad030719caafc8fa
spent
true